The log from the sea of cortez describes a marine biology expedition carried out by john steinbeck and his close friend, ed ricketts, from march 11 to april 20, 1940. The expedition leaves monterey bay, california, travels down the coast of baja california and into the sea of cortez, then returns. Steinbeck and ricketts then produced a book, sea of cortez, of which the narrative section is normally reprinted as the log from the sea of cortez.

The log from the sea of cortez, an account of the 1940 marine biological expedition in which steinbeck participated with his close friend ed ricketts, is a unique blend of science, philosophy, and adventure, as well as one of steinbecks most revealing expositions of his core beliefs.
